May 2025 - Apr 2026Ironmonger Row area has the 8th highest crime rate of 25 local areas in Bunhill , and the 65th highest crime rate of 506 local areas in Islington .
This postcode sits in a local crime hotspot. Overall crime levels here are significantly higher than in the surrounding streets and the wider area.
The overall crime rate in the area around Ironmonger Row (EC1V 3QW) in the last 12 months was 362.6 per 1,000 residents and was 12.4% higher than the Bunhill average (322.5 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Anti-social behaviour with 102 offences recorded. The least common crime was Bicycle theft with 2 cases , up 100.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Bicycle theft 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Criminal damage and arson ( -20.0%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 56 (≈ 106.9 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were flat ( 0.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has rising ( 90.6%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the area around Ironmonger Row (EC1V 3QW), the highest concentration of overall crime is near Galway Street, where police recorded 120 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near Lever Street (59 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
